A Priest's Handbook by Dennis G Michno

An authoritative priestly guidebook of the hows and whys of the Episcopal liturgy.

The definitive reference work that simplifies liturgical officiating and celebrating of the rites of the Episcopal Church. A Priest's Handbook explains the appropriate use of vestments, color, altar preparation, as well as gestures and movements during the various services. It also explores the particular prayer and liturgical options for the Holy Eucharist, Holy Week, Baptism, and other events in the Church's calendar. Sections on the use of the lectionary and the Daily Offices make this handbook truly comprehensive.

Michno, Dennis G.: - Dennis Michno was an Episcopal priest and served as a consultant to the Standing Liturgical Commission in the revision of The Book of Common Prayer. He was the author ofA Priest's Handbook and A Manual for Acolytes.He died in September 2018.
